EFFECT OF VERMICOMPOST TREATMENT ON OIL QUALITY AND FATTY ACID COMPOSITION OF PEANUT (Arachis Hypogaea L.)    

Dr. Mustafa YILMAZ
Abstract


This research was conducted under Osmaniye ecological conditions to determine the effect of vermicompost treatment on oil quality and fatty acid compositions of peanut (Arachis hypogaea L.) in 2020-2021. The research was designed in a randomized complete block design with three replications. Peanut variety NC 7 was used in the study. Vermicompost was applied in nine different doses. In the study, oil content, oleic acid, linoleic acid, palmitic acid, stearic acid, behenic acid, arachidic acid, O/L ratio and iodine value were investigated. According to the results, it has been found that oil content varies between 48.38% (T9) and 50.43% (T5). The ratio of oleic acid was recorded between 56.90% (T9) and 59.42% (T5) while the ratio of linoleic acid between 21.15% (T9) and 23.59% (T8). Lowest palmitic acid value (8.87%) was recorded for T8 treatment whereas highest palmitic acid value (9.21%) was obtained from T6 treatment. Lowest O/L ratio (2.42) was obtained from T8 treatment while highest O/L ratio (2.77) was obtained from T4 treatment. The iodine value varied between 85.56% and 90.28% for T9 and T5 application, respectively. The findings indicate that under the ecological conditions of Osmaniye, soil and foliar treatment of vermicompost show a significant increase in oil content, oleic acid, linoleic acid and iodine values of peanut.
